Brewery saves 5,000 gallons of water per day with new pump

Water costs go down and so do extra-strength charges in sewage costs
Wayne Labs, Senior Contributing Technical Editor
Wayne Labs
October 12, 2018

When a food or beverage processor begins breaking down costs, sometimes startling facts are revealed. Here’s a case in point: Widmer Brothers Brewery (Portland, Ore.), founded in 1984 and part of the Craft Brew Alliance (CBA), had been using a liquid ring vacuum pump to bottle its beers, but realized the technology was consuming roughly 5,000 gallons of water per day.
